When to Replace

  • The interior refrigerator light does not turn on when the door is opened.
  • The interior refrigerator light remains on when the door is closed.

Installation Tips

  • Disconnect the refrigerator from the power source before beginning the installation.
  • The old switch can typically be removed by depressing its locking tabs.
  • The new switch snaps into place for a secure fit.

The most common symptom is that the interior refrigerator light fails to turn on when the door is opened, or conversely, stays on even when the door is closed. If you notice the light flickering or the refrigerator cooling performance dropping because the light is generating heat inside the cabinet, the switch is likely failing.
Installing this switch is generally straightforward and can usually be completed in about 10 to 15 minutes. You will typically need a flat-head screwdriver or a putty knife to gently pry the old switch out of its housing. Always ensure the refrigerator is unplugged or the power is disconnected before beginning the installation.
This switch acts as a sensor for the refrigerator door. When the door is opened, the button extends to complete the circuit and illuminate the interior light. When the door is closed, it depresses the button, breaking the circuit to turn the light off, which helps conserve energy and prevents unnecessary heat buildup inside the unit.
